    I am glad to see that there are still people willing to pay a little more for a much better product. I have the fox 2.5 coils with the TC UCA on my truck and worked at Fox for about 8 years. The Allpro kit that has the 2.0 shock with the C/D adjuster is definitely a nice looking and working kit. Having the coil-over and the 8 way compression adjuster knob is so cool because now this one shock has a whole lot of adjustment to dial in exactly how YOU like it. To fit you're driving needs.
